Paul, I agree with your point that more people in an area whether it is residential or business will in general create more road traffic. Of course "more traffic" needs to be looked at in the context of the long term decline of traffic volumes in London. "more traffic" may mean the same volume of traffic there was a few years ago but less than traffic volumes in the 2000s. As an example, traffic over Chiswick Bridge has gone up following the closure of Hammersmith Bridge to motor traffic but it is still only at the same level as the traffic in 2007 and less than the traffic in the years before then.
